What Is E-E-A-T in SEO?

E-E-A-T stands for:

  • Experience – Have you personally experienced the topic you’re writing about?
  • Expertise – Do you have the credentials or knowledge to talk about it?
  • Authoritativeness – Are you or your brand recognized as a reliable source?
  • Trustworthiness – Can your audience trust your content, design, and reputation?

Google uses these signals to evaluate content quality, especially in YMYL (Your Money or Your Life) topics like health, finance, and legal content.

Why Google E-E-A-T Guidelines Matter

Google’s algorithms have become better at detecting content written for users, not search engines. The Google E-E-A-T guidelines help the search engine assess whether your content is:

  • Useful and well-informed
  • Created by someone with direct experience
  • Published on a trustworthy website
  • Factually accurate and transparent

Ignoring E-E-A-T can mean lower rankings—even if your on-page SEO is perfect.

Top E-E-A-T SEO Ranking Factors

To improve your rankings, focus on these core E-E-A-T SEO ranking factors:

  1. Author bios with credentials
    Highlight expertise and experience of content creators.

  2. External references and citations
    Use trusted sources to back up your claims.

  3. Site reputation and backlinks
    Build authoritative links and maintain brand mentions across the web.

  4. Transparency
    Include contact info, about pages, editorial policies, and privacy terms.

  5. User experience and design
    Clean, secure, and mobile-friendly websites perform better in trust evaluation.

How to Build an E-E-A-T Content Strategy

Your E-E-A-T content strategy should focus on real-world value and user trust. Here’s how to get started:

  • Create content based on personal experience
    Add stories, case studies, and real-life examples.

  • Feature qualified authors
    Show their professional credentials and links to their profiles.

  • Use structured content formats
    Easy-to-scan layouts, bullet points, and headings improve trust and readability.

  • Keep content accurate and updated
    Outdated or false info can harm trust signals and rankings.

  • Optimize for brand reputation
    Engage in PR, reviews, and guest posts to build authority.

By aligning your strategy with E-E-A-T principles, you not only gain higher search visibility but also build lasting trust with your audience.
